Denver defeated Orlando 126–115 on December 18 at Ball Arena, with Jamal Murray leading the Nuggets with 32 points while Nikola Jokić added 23 in a balanced offensive attack. The Nuggets shot 55.7 percent from the field and connected on 16 three-pointers, establishing control through a dominant second quarter that yielded 43 points and set the tone for the contest. Orlando's Paolo Banchero and Wendell Carter Jr. each scored 26 points, but the Magic's 47.3 percent shooting and 11 three-pointers proved insufficient against Denver's offensive efficiency. Denver's 31 assists and 40 rebounds powered a 122.8 offensive rating, while holding Orlando to a 115.6 offensive rating.
